WEB静态服务器
单进程、线程、非堵塞、、长连接的http服务器
代码示例如下:
import socket
import re
def service_client(new_socket, request):
"""为这个客户端返回数据"""
# # 1、接收浏览器发送过来的请求,即http请求
# # GET / HTTP/1.1
# # ......
# global response
# request = new_socket.recv(1024).decode("utf-8")
# # print(">>" * 50)
# # print(request)
request_lines = request.splitlines()
print("")
print(">"*50)
print(request_lines)
# GET /index.html HTTP/1.1
# get post put del 正则1:r"[^/]+(/[^ ]*)" 正则2:r".*(/.*?\..*?) HTTP.*"
file_name = ""
req_str = re.search(r"[?/html](/.*?\..*?) HTTP.*", request_lines[0]) # 匹配第一个元素的 ‘HTTP’ 之前的文件名
print(req_str)
if req_str:
file_name = req_str.group(1)
print("*"*50, file_name)
if file_name == "/":
file_name = "/html/index.html"
# 2、返回 http格式的数据,给浏览器
try:
file = open("./html" + file_name, "rb")
except IOError:
# 404表示没有这个页面
response = "HTTP/1.1 404 NOT FOUND\r\n"
response += "\r\n"
response += "------FILE NOT FOUND------"
new_socket.send(response.encode("utf-8"))
else:
html_content = file.read()
file.close()
response_body = html_content
# 2.1、准备发送给浏览器的数据---header
response_header = "HTTP/1.1 200 OK\r\n"
response_header += "Content-Length:%d\r\n" % len(html_content) # 长连接
response_header += "\r\n"
response = response_header.encode("utf-8") + response_body # 二进制
# 2.2、准备发送给浏览器的数据---body
# 将response header 发送给浏览器
new_socket.send(response)
# 关闭套接字
# new_socket.close()
def main():
"""作为程序的主控制入口"""
# 1、创建套接字
tcp_server_socket =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
# 2、绑定
tcp_server_socket.bind(("", 12708))
# 3、变为监听套接字
tcp_server_socket.listen(128)
tcp_server_socket.setblocking(False) # 将套接字变为非堵塞
client_socket_list = list()
while True:
# 4、等待新客户端 的链接
try:
new_socket, client_addr = tcp_server_socket.accept()
except Exception as ret_info:
pass
else:
new_socket.setblocking(False)
client_socket_list.append(new_socket)
for client_socket in client_socket_list:
try:
recv_data = client_socket.recv(1024).decode("utf-8")
except Exception as ret_info:
pass
else:
if recv_data:
service_client(client_socket, recv_data)
else:
client_socket.close()
client_socket_list.remove(client_socket)
# 关闭套接字
tcp_server_socket.close()
if __name__ == "__main__":
main()
